# Quotas: Larkspun GraphQL Resolver Batching

The order-history resolver on Larkspun previously issued one database query per line item, producing classic N+1 fan-out under load. We replaced it with a dataloader that batches lookups within a single tick. Batch sizes, wait windows, and per-request query budgets are now enforced server-side; exceeding the budget returns a partial response with an extensions warning rather than an error. The current enforced limits are listed in the following table.

tuning constants:
QUOTAS = {
    "druwyn": 5,
    "holix": 5,
    "zorath": 5,
    "holwyn": 10,
}

Handover: Dryce calendar sync

For the release manager. The Wrenfold sync worker double-books when two sources edit the same slot within the debounce window. Root cause: conflict resolution runs before the remote etag refresh. Fix is in branch dryce-conflict-order, tested against staging tenants, no data loss observed. Hold the 3.2 release until it merges. Do not re-enable auto-merge for recurring events; it masks the bug. The worker currently runs with the following configuration.

config for kafof-bawef:
holath:
  log_level: debug
  metrics_host: metrics.holath.qorvelsys.internal
  pin: 2191
  pool_size: 32

## Authentication

The Ratefern cache service refreshes tax-rate tables nightly from the internal Levyline source of record. All refresh and manual-flush operations require an API key scoped to the release environment. Keys are rotated at the start of each release cycle, so earlier keys in older runbooks will not work. Configure the deployment with the current credential, which is provided below.

app token of bahaf-tajeg = zpat23_SjjsllwiLmXbtS65veZaV47